1. The Price Tag: More Than Just Fluffy Dreams 🛒
So, how much does a Golden Retriever puppy cost? Brace yourself—breeders typically charge anywhere from $800 to $3,000 in the U.S., depending on pedigree and location. But wait! That’s just the starting point. 🐶✨
Fun fact: Show-quality pups (yes, those destined for fame) can easily hit $5,000+. And let’s be honest—if you’re adopting instead of buying, shelter fees might run around $200-$400. Adoption = instant karma points though. 🙏
2. Hidden Costs: When Life Gets Paw-some 💸
Alright, now that you’ve brought home your furry sunshine, it’s time for reality checks. Food, vet visits, grooming, toys—you name it. Here’s a rough breakdown:
- Annual food bill: $400-$700 (Goldens love to eat!) 🍖
- Vet checkups & vaccines: $200-$500 per year
- Grooming sessions: $30-$60 every 6-8 weeks (because shedding is *real*) 🌬️
Pro tip: Budget an extra $1,000 annually for emergencies like surgeries or unexpected illnesses. Because Murphy’s Law always applies with pets. 😅
3. Long-Term Commitment: Are You In It for Life? 🕰️
A Golden Retriever isn’t just a short-term investment—it’s a 10-12 year journey filled with cuddles, chaos, and unconditional love. Ask yourself: Can I handle this level of devotion? These dogs thrive on attention and exercise, so if you’re planning to lock them in a tiny apartment all day… well, good luck. They’ll probably chew your couch into oblivion faster than you can say “sit.” 🛋️🔥
Also, don’t forget training classes ($100-$300+) unless you want a 70-pound bundle of energy running wild through your living room. Trust me, obedience pays off big time. 🎯
